java //榨汁机 有榨汁的功能 //把多种水果放到榨汁机里通过榨汁机的榨汁功能榨成汁
时间: 2023-08-01 10:10:11 浏览: 111
水果榨汁机
5星 · 资源好评率100%
在Java中实现榨汁机的功能可以使用面向对象的思想进行设计。下面是一个简单的示例代码:
```java
import java.util.ArrayList;
import java.util.List;
class Fruit {
private String name;
public Fruit(String name) {
this.name = name;
}
public String getName() {
return name;
}
}
class Juicer {
public List<String> juice(List<Fruit> fruits) {
List<String> juice = new ArrayList<>();
for (Fruit fruit : fruits) {
juice.add(fruit.getName() + "汁");
}
return juice;
}
}
public class Main {
public static void main(String[] args) {
Juicer juicer = new Juicer();
List<Fruit> fruits = new ArrayList<>();
fruits.add(new Fruit("苹果"));
fruits.add(new Fruit("橘子"));
fruits.add(new Fruit("香蕉"));
List<String> juice = juicer.juice(fruits);
for (String j : juice) {
System.out.println(j);
}
}
}
```
在这个示例中,我们定义了一个`Fruit`类表示水果,它有一个`name`属性用于表示水果的名称。然后我们定义了一个`Juicer`类表示榨汁机,它有一个`juice`方法,接收一个水果列表作为参数,并返回榨成汁后的结果列表。最后在`Main`类中创建一个榨汁机实例,并将多种水果放入榨汁机中进行榨汁操作,然后打印出榨成的汁液。
以上代码只是一个简单的示例,您可以根据实际需求进行更加复杂的设计和实现。希望对您有所帮助!如果您有其他问题,请随时提问。
阅读全文